Ok so I have a 2004 Tahoe Z71. So here is the story. It shifted fine but had some clogged cats and a knock sensor code. It had no acceleration and could barley make it up a steep hill. I replaced the knock sensors and the cats. It drove ok and then it just started revving ALLLL the way up to 6k rpms in first unless you let off the gas. If you let off the gas, it'll shift to second but always puts it at around 2k rpms. It won't go past 2,200 rpms in second but pulls just fine. Even going up a hill. It want's to shift back to first at lower speeds. It acts fine otherwise. If I'm doing highway driving it acts fine.
Now if I stay at low speeds, like 3k rpms or lower, the truck will shift into 2nd gear just fine. It's only when I gun it that I have to let off. I thought maybe the knock sensor was preventing it from going over 2,200 rpms in second or maybe there is a reset. However that is not the case. I'm thinking about trying to change the shift solenoids. I'm here to get any other opinions on what this may be. It really doesn't seem like the transmission at all. It showed no signs of slippage or anything irregular whatsoever before this.
